Please I need your understanding with my challenges. In 2011 August, I was arrested for using someone’s Belgium passport to work in the UK. During this time I was granted a limited leave to remain cux my eu partner was already pregnant and I then applied for residence permit after my child was born n was granted 5years. But was given a caution for the Belgium passport I used by the British police back then.

My question now is, at present I hold permanent residence card and I have now been 4weeks overdue for naturalisation/british citizenship, if I apply now will it be granted considering the caution I received in 2011 for using a Belgium passport that belong to someone else please?

Will I need a English B1 test considering I am now studying computer science in a UK university? Can I use my admission letter as proof of English language please?

Will I need a English B1 test considering I am now studying computer science in a UK university?
Yes.
Phase10 wrote:
Wed Aug 15, 2018 3:05 am
Can I use my admission letter as proof of English language please?
No. You need to have graduated from the course. Being admitted to a course in a UK university is not enough.
Phase10 wrote:
Wed Aug 15, 2018 3:05 am
In 2011 August, I was arrested for using someone’s Belgium passport to work in the UK... if I apply now will it be granted considering the caution I received in 2011 for using a Belgium passport that belong to someone else please?
By using someone else's passport, you have committed two offenses at the very least; deception and being in the UK illegally.

If it is on your record with the Home Office, you do not qualify for naturalisation for 10 years from the time you became legal in the UK (i.e. from the date of issue of your Residence Card as a durable partner of an EEA citizen, as it sounds like you did not marry your EEA citizen partner).

I am married to my EEA and still married. So you mean I will not be granted naturalisation till 2021?
Yes. The fact that you were (a) illegally in the UK and (b) using somebody else's passport count against your good character.
Phase10 wrote:
Wed Aug 15, 2018 4:25 am
Also, how do I know if this is on my record at the home office?
Apply for an SAR with the Home Office.
Phase10 wrote:
Wed Aug 15, 2018 4:25 am
I have had a change of job for 4 different times since 2011 and all required a DBS check which all came out as nothing on my record, even the 2011 caution was not showing on my DBS so please could you kindly explained further?
The good character requirements for naturalisation are much stricter than basic DBS checks. Go through the linked to PDF file.
